what is spermathecal pore ?

Spermatheca is an accessory organ in females in some insects having an opening into the common oviduct. It stores sperms which are released by the males during copulation. Spermathecal pores are multiple inconspicuous minute pores or openings in this organ found in some animals like earthworms. 

  • 10
